Job Description

  

We are currently seeking a Test Technician Intern to support our manufacturing team in the production of oscilloscopes, probes, and cables. In this role, you will test, troubleshoot, and repair LeCroy instruments at both the system and component levels. You’ll have the opportunity to collaborate across departments, work closely with product design engineers, and help bring new products to life on the manufacturing floor.

This is a hands-on role ideal for students with a genuine interest in electronics, test engineering, and hardware manufacturing.

Responsibilities

  • Test, troubleshoot, and repair oscilloscopes, probes, and electronic assemblies under supervision.
  • Operate software-driven test stations.
  • Learn to interpret production drawings and schematics to identify and resolve failures.
  • Operate test equipment such as oscilloscopes, waveform generators, network analyzers, multimeters, and power supplies with guidance from experienced technicians.
  • Provide feedback and support to improve engineering test processes, including evaluating test procedures, equipment, workflows, and contributing to documentation updates.
  • Participate in team meetings and support key metrics and initiatives.

Required Qualifications

  • Currently enrolled in a related 2 or 4-year program such as:
    • Electrical/Electronics Engineering
    • Electrical/Electronics Engineering Technology
    • Electronics Technician Certificate
    • or a related program
  • Minimum 1 year of program credits
  • Familiarity with test and measurement equipment (oscilloscopes, multimeters, waveform generators).
  • Ability to interpret production drawings, schematics, and manufacturing procedures written in English.
  • Comfortability utilizing Microsoft Office tools (Excel, Outlook, Teams, etc.).
  • Strong analytical, critical thinking, and hands-on learning capabilities.

Preferred Qualifications and Experience

  • Genuine interest in the electronics industry.
  • Basic soldering ability or prior electronics lab experience.
  • Ability to tailor communication (both written and verbal) to your audience.
  • Familiarity with coding, scripting, or databases.
  • Exposure to Arduino, microcontrollers, or basic embedded systems.
  • Experience with 3D printing software and simple mechanical prototyping.
